WebJun 4, 2011 · Both patient and medication factors can contribute to the occurrence of a breakthrough seizure. Patient factors include the onset of an infection, severe emotional stress, sleep deprivation, or metabolic events such as a decrease in sodium levels or severe changes in blood sugar level.
